Huawei has started sending a new HarmonyOS update for its selected devices including Mate 30, P40, and MatePad Pro series in the form of v2.0.0.135 and 2.0.0.138. Now, the same changelog update is rolling out to the Huawei Nova 7 SE 5G, Nova 7 SE 5G Lohas version smartphone users.

The latest HarmonyOS update for the Huawei Nova 7 SE 5G, Nova 7 SE 5G Lohas version is rolling out with the build number HarmonyOS 2.0.0.145.

Huawei Nova 7 SE 5G, Nova 7 SE 5G Lohas version HarmonyOS 2.0.0.145 CHANGELOG:

Version:

  • 2.0.0.128→ 2.0.0.145
  • 2.0.0.128→2.0.0.145

Changes:

  • Support HUAWEI FreeBuds 4 earphones (need to be updated to the latest version), pull and close, mobile phone sound seamlessly flows to the earphones.
  • Optimizes the app and smart voice.

Huawei Nova 7 SE 5G Lohas Edition Specifications:

  • Dimension: Length 162.31 mm, Width 75.0 mm, Thickness 8.58 mm
  • Weight: 187g
  • Screen Size: 6.5 inches
  • Screen Color: 16.7 million colors, color saturation (NTSC): 96%
  • Screen Type: LTPS LCD
  • Resolution: 2400 x 1080 pixels
  • Processor: HUAWEI Kirin 820E
  • CPU Cores: Six-core
  • CPU Frequency: 3 x Cortex-A76 Based 2.22 GHz + 3 x Cortex-A55 1.84 GHz
  • GPU: Mali-G57
  • OS: EMUI10.1 (based on Android 10)
  • Storage: 8 GB RAM + 128 GB ROM
  • Extended Storage: Support NM memory card, maximum support 256 GB
  • Rear Camera: 64MP  (f/1.8 aperture) + 8MP (f/2.4 aperture) + 2MP (f/2.4 aperture) + 2MP  (f/2.4 aperture)
  • Zoom: 10x digital zoom
  • Front Camera: 16MP f/2.0
  • Battery: 4000 mAh
  • Network: Primary [5G network standard: Mobile 5G (NR) / Unicom 5G (NR) / Telecom 5G (NR), 4G network standard: Mobile 4G (TD-LTE) / Unicom 4G (TD-LTE/LTE FDD) / Telecom 4G (TD-LTE/LTE FDD), 3G network standard: Unicom 3G (WCDMA)/Telecom 3G (CDMA 2000), 2G network standard: Mobile 2G (GSM) / Unicom 2G (GSM) / Telecom 2G (CDMA 1X)] Secondary [4G network standard: Mobile 4G (TD-LTE) / Unicom 4G (TD-LTE/LTE FDD) / Telecom 4G (TD-LTE/LTE FDD), 3G network standard: Unicom 3G (WCDMA), 2G network standard: Mobile 2G (GSM) / Unicom 2G (GSM) / Telecom 2G (CDMA 1X)]
  • Bluetooth: Bluetooth 5.1, support BLE, SBC, AAC
  • Sensor: Ambient light sensor, Fingerprint sensor, Compass, Proximity light sensor, Gravity sensor, Gyro

Kirin 820E Specs: 5G processor with 7nm process technology (Cortex-A76, 1 large Cortex-A76, 3 medium Cortex-A76, 4 small Cortex-A55 core, 6-core Mali-G57 GPU) Kirin Gaming + 2.0, and Da Vinci NPU core.

The FutureNet World 2025 event just completed in London, bringing together over 700 industry leaders to talk about the future of network technology. The yearly gathering attracts top executives from global telecom companies, standards organizations, and technology suppliers. For the first time ever, the event created a special “Intelligent Network Best Practice Award” – and Huawei won the prize.

The company stands for its innovative work on smart, self-managing networks. Huawei’s winning technology helps telecom companies run their networks more intelligently with less human intervention. Their solution includes smart digital assistants designed for network maintenance, improving customer experience, and business operations.

These digital helpers fall into two main categories – the Mate series and the Spirit series. The technology has already been rolled out in many countries, showing impressive results across different types of networks including IP, optical, wireless, and core systems. Speaking at the event, Wang Shaosen, who leads Huawei’s smart network solutions, shared the company’s vision: “We’re committed to developing technology that makes networks smarter.

This will help telecom companies succeed with advanced 5G services and prepare for the future of 6G connectivity.

According to the official information, the Huawei released the delisting announcement of its Petal Mail App. The full text of the announcement is as follows: [translated]

Thank you for your continued attention and support to the Huawei Petal Mail App. In order to better adapt to the changing needs of product experience, service content and local markets, we have made strategic adjustments to the Huawei Petal Mail App.

The Petal Mail App will officially switch to the Email App on December 31, 2024, and the Petal Mail App will no longer be available for download from the App Store. The Petal Mail App you have installed can be used normally. We apologize for the inconvenience. You can continue to view, send or receive emails in the pre-installed Email App on your Huawei phone or use a computer browser to open the Petal Mail official website ( https://www.petalmail.com ), and your emails and personal data will not be lost.
